Come along for a fascinating journey into the skies and habitats right on our doorstep! 

We are delighted to welcome Mike Ilett from the Hertfordshire Natural History Society, co-author of Birds of Hertfordshire, to share his knowledge of our local feathered residents.  

Whether you’re a lifelong birdwatcher or simply enjoy seeing a robin in your garden, this talk will unlock the secret life of North Hertfordshire’s feathered friends. Mike will guide us through the key habitats that make our region special, revealing which birds we are most likely to spot, and what makes our local ecology so rich.

Mike will share incredible sightings and stories of the most unusual birds recorded in North Herts. It’s a chance to truly connect with the natural world of our county.
